Tigers Open 2020-21 Season at Home Today

Greencastle, Ind. - The DePauw men's basketball team returns to the hardwood this afternoon at 3 p.m. as it hosts Greenville University in the Tigers' first contest of the 2020-21 season. Spectators will not be permitted to attend, but fans can follow the game through the live stat and video links above.

DePauw returns 10 letterwinners including starters at four of the five positions from last year's 14-12 team. Senior forward Nolan Ginther (Noblesville, Ind./Noblesville) was a second team all-North Coast Athletic Conference performer last year after earning honorable mention his sophomore campaign. Ginther paced the Tigers last season with 14.7 points, 6.5 rebounds and 1.2 steals. Senior guard Nick Felke (Plymouth, Ind./Plymouth) was an honorable mention all-conference pick last year after scoring 14.0 points per contest and leading the squad with 3.8 assists and nearly two 3-pointers per contest.

Senior forward Josh Hall (Bloomington, Ind./Bloomington South) rounds out the double-digit returning scorers after averaging 11.2 points per outing in a season that was shortended due to injury in early January. Senior forward Aaron Shank (Fishers, Ind./Hamilton Southeastern) and sophomore guard Elijah Hales (Topeka, Ind./Westview) also are back as starters from last season. This year's team also features six seniors with guards Ken Decker (Crown Point, Ind./Crown Point) and Matthew Godfrey (Carmel, Ind./Guerin Catholic) joining the four returning starters.

Greenville is 0-3 after losses to three NCAA Division I opponents in late November and early December. The Panthers, who run the "system", average 100.0 points per game, while allowing 162.7. Kenneth Cooley leads the way with 20.3 points, followed by Romello Ball (11.7) and Travis Dickey (10.7). 

The season is Bill Fenlon's 29th as the Tigers' head coach and his 35th overall including stops at Sewanee, Rose-Hulman and Southwestern prior to coming to DePauw in the spring of 1992. His teams have posted a 564-350 overall record, while his DePauw squads are 457-281.
